At a time when the future of Paytm's payments business is being questioned due to a regulatory crisis, sources say that the fintech major is putting the finishing touches to a deal to acquire Bitsila, an interoperable e-commerce startup.

Bengaluru-based Bitsila is currently the third largest seller side platform by transactions on the Open Network for Digital Commerce (ONDC), sources said. The deal is in advanced stages and will likely close in the coming week, according to two people in the know.

Moneycontrol could not confirm the deal size and whether it is for cash or stock.

Bitsila, founded by Dasharatham Bitla and Sooryah Pokkali in 2020, has previously raised a pre-seed round from Antler India and Redbus founder Phanindra Sama.
